The chess tablebase files are generated by the Gaviota Engine whose
license is clearly not DFSG compatible. However, the author is
releasing the generated database files under the MIT license. Is the
MIT license for these database files DFSG compatible? [...]
On Wed, Jun 5, 2013 at 6:13 PM, MJ Ray wrote:
The Gaviota Engine licence shouldn't apply to the database files. See
http://www.gnu.org/licenses/gpl-faq.html#GPLOutput for a similar topic.
Sounds like they should go to contrib though, due to the non-free build-dep?
